The St. Croix River offers solitude and solace, scenery and diverse species, and sunshine and sand.

The year 2020 made those qualities even more valuable.

This collection of essays and scattering poems, written from winter through late fall, follows adventures on the water and on the bluffs, tracing the year’s uncertain arc. The stories are found on foot, paddling a canoe or kayak, and by boat.

These words are an ode to the river, the many living things that call it home — and a priceless place for many people.

The St. Croix provides respite, reassurance, and awe all year long. River of Refuge lets you experience it any time you open the book.
